John Douglas Abernethy
Passed away peacefully surrounded by family in Port Perry on February 7th, 2024, at the age of 74.
Much loved and missed son of Muriel and beloved Rae. Adored big brother to Laurel, Alan, Ron, and Jill. Loving father (“Daddio”) of Tammy and Bryan (Judy). Cherished grandchildren, Bradyn, Savannah, Makayla, and Hailey. Proud uncle of Danny (Kelly) and Marci (Jonathan), and great uncle of Madison, Gavin, Dylan, Emmett, and Caleb.
Doug was born and raised in Bowmanville, brought up working in the paint & wallpaper business since approximately the age of 12 years old. He was the 3rd generation in the family business, running the store for the last 40 years out of the 74 years that it operated with the family. The family business originally started out as a decorating company in 1921 with Doug’s grandfather Jim Abernethy. Jim went on to open the retail store, Abernethy’s Paint & Wallpaper Ltd. in 1949 which eventually passed down to Doug’s father Rae Abernethy.
Doug’s childhood instilled a lifelong passion for baseball, dancing, and skipping school to play pool. He will be remembered as a family man who loved spending time with his family and friends, while still being a private soul who loved to relax to books and music. He had a good sense of humour as big as his heart. He will be sadly missed by his family and friends.
